Branch Coverage

lib/Convert/Number/Ethiopic.pm
Criterion Covered Total %
branch 37 46 80.4


line true false branch
50 0 190 if ($#_ > 1)
54 0 190 unless ($number =~ /^\d+$/ or $number =~ /^[\x{1369}-\x{137c}]+$/)
75 0 1 if @_
87 9 86 if length $_[0]{'number'} == 1
106 86 0 if ($] >= 5.012) { }
117 86 0 if ($] >= 5.012) { }
126 86 0 if ($] >= 5.012) { }
136 86 0 if ($] >= 5.012) { }
143 86 0 if ($] >= 5.012) { }
150 86 0 if ($] >= 5.012) { }
179 4 91 unless $n
182 50 41 unless ($n % 2)
212 120 196 if $aTen
213 185 131 if $aOne
227 90 46 $eTen ne '' || $eOne ne '' ? :
136 89 $pos ? :
225 91 $place ? :
245 72 244 if ($eOne eq "\x{1369}" and $eTen eq '')
246 29 43 if ($sep eq "\x{137b}") { }
23 20 elsif ($place + 1 == $n) { }
279 95 95 if @_
281 95 95 $self->number =~ /^[0-9]+$/ ? :
292 190 190 if @_